One of the most sought-after courses is the Certificate III in Meat Processing (Meat Safety) AMP30316. This course focuses on upholding safety standards and ensuring compliance with industry regulations, which is vital in maintaining the health of consumers in Sunbury. Learning about meat safety not only enhances your career prospects but also prepares you to thrive in a regulated work environment.

Another excellent option is the Certificate III in Meat Processing (General) AMP30616. This course provides a comprehensive overview of various meat processing practices, making it an ideal starting point for anyone interested in general meat packing roles. By acquiring diverse skills and knowledge, you can position yourself for various job roles within the local meat industry in Sunbury.

If you're interested in the food service aspect of meat processing, the Certificate III in Meat Processing (Food Services) AMP30216 is the right fit for you. This course emphasizes skills related to food presentation and customer service while working with meat products. Graduates can expect to provide valuable contributions to local establishments in Sunbury that require food service expertise.

Finally, for those keen on delving into the production of smallgoods, the Certificate III in Meat Processing (Smallgoods - Manufacture) AMP31016 will teach you how to produce a range of specialty meat products. This unique skill set can open many doors within the meat industry and is especially relevant to job roles that cater to niche markets in Sunbury.
